Rice Hope Plantation (established in 1696 by Daniel Huger as Luckins) prospered as a prominent Cooper River plantation in the days when rice was king in the Carolinas. The original house burned and was rebuilt on the same foundation in 1840.

In Jacksonville at the turn of the century, fifty mansions lined Riverside Avenue in an area known as "The Row". Only two of these fabulous mansions remain, and the newly renovated and refurbished Riverdale Inn is one of them.
